We've got another exciting Central Division matchup on schedule as the Detroit Pistons and the Chicago Bulls are set to tip at 7:00 p.m. ET on Thursday at Little Caesars Arena. Detroit is 13-66 overall and 7-32 at home, while Chicago is 37-42 overall and 17-21 on the road. The Bulls are favored by 9.5 points in the latest Pistons vs. Bulls odds, and the over/under is 218.5 points.
